Configuring DNS

Use the following procedure to check the settings for DNS Configuration.
Checking these settings assumes that the DNS service is enabled on the
Windows 2003 server. The OCS servers are also using this DNS server.

Checking that DNS is correctly configured

Step

Action

1

On the DNS server, select _tcp.

2

Select _sipinternaltls.

3

Right-click and select Properties.

4

Click on the Service Location (SRV) tab.

5

Check that the sipinternal SRV records are configured properly. See
example

Figure 125 "sipinternaltls SRV records" (page 287)

for the

settings for sipinternaltls SRV records.
